Output 21003784f31fa3dc8f2e856c2d798169a4a24b659a65c295c341d69f1d2c1ae6:3

value
1486000
script pubkey
OP_0 OP_PUSHBYTES_20 2ed490b1c6f1da4c8e88a2d39c0b3d12ad0a8cba
address
bc1q9m2fpvwx78dyer5g5tfeczeaz2ks4r96wlqah6
transaction
21003784f31fa3dc8f2e856c2d798169a4a24b659a65c295c341d69f1d2c1ae6
spent
true